Output 61caa4ac41eb174d492df263ca88986ac39ccdbc720b9bcb10a17536f0d4aa68:0

value
939293
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50e4f38edc2c607f36e5d8c5f108c9c4d094d83f OP_EQUALVERIFY OP_CHECKSIG
address
18NjLAmowHi5EtyxwvYHbATeEnihVdH2Dk
transaction
61caa4ac41eb174d492df263ca88986ac39ccdbc720b9bcb10a17536f0d4aa68
confirmations
459204
spent
true